use super::generator::*;
use {proc_macro2::*, quote::*};
impl EnumGenerator {
/// Generate `impl Resolve`.
pub fn generate_impl_resolve(&self) -> TokenStream {
let mut segments = Vec::<TokenStream>::default();
let annotated_parameter = self.annotated_parameter();
let (impl_generics, type_generics, where_clause) = self.generics(&annotated_parameter);
let enum_name = &self.enum_name;
let quoted_enum_name = enum_name.to_string().to_token_stream();
let human_readable_key_list = &self.human_readable_key_list;
let handle_single_variant = match &self.single_variant {
Some(single_variant) => self.generate_handle_single_variant(single_variant),
None => Default::default(),
};
for select_variant in &self.select_variants {
segments.push(self.generate_handle_variant(select_variant));
}
quote! {
#[automatically_derived]
impl
#impl_generics
Resolve<#enum_name #type_generics, #annotated_parameter>
for ::compris::normal::Variant<#annotated_parameter>
#where_clause
{
fn resolve_with_errors<ErrorReceiverT>(self, errors: &mut ErrorReceiverT) ->
::compris::resolve::ResolveResult<#enum_name #type_generics, #annotated_parameter>
where ErrorReceiverT:
::kutil::std::error::ErrorReceiver<::compris::resolve::ResolveError<#annotated_parameter>>
{
let maybe_annotations = ::compris::annotate::Annotated::maybe_annotations(&self);
let type_name = self.type_name();
#handle_single_variant
::compris::resolve::ResolveResult::Ok(
match self.into_key_value_pair() {
::std::option::Option::Some((key, value)) => match key {
Self::Text(text) => match text.as_str() {
#(#segments)*
key => {
::kutil::std::error::ErrorReceiver::give_error(
errors,
::compris::annotate::Annotated::with_annotations_from(
::compris::normal::MalformedError::new(
#quoted_enum_name.into(),
format!("key is not {}: {}", #human_readable_key_list, key),
).into(),
&maybe_annotations
),
)?;
::std::option::Option::None
}
}
_ => {
::kutil::std::error::ErrorReceiver::give_error(
errors,
::compris::annotate::Annotated::with_annotations_from(
::compris::normal::IncompatibleVariantTypeError::new(
type_name.into(),
vec!["text".into()]
).into(),
&maybe_annotations,
),
)?;
::std::option::Option::None
}
}
::std::option::Option::None => {
::kutil::std::error::ErrorReceiver::give_error(
errors,
::compris::annotate::Annotated::with_annotations_from(
::compris::normal::MalformedError::new(
"map".into(),
"is not a single-key map".into(),
).into(),
&maybe_annotations
),
)?;
::std::option::Option::None
}
}
)
}
}
}
}
}
